Hotel Rooms, Meeting Space in Sarasota To Grow Significantly

August 7, 2017

A surge of new hotel openings will add 1,112 new hotel rooms to Sarasota County’s accommodation offerings within a two-year span of time. The majority of these hotel rooms will be located in the downtown center of Sarasota within walking distance of restaurants, Sarasota Bay, and arts and cultural offerings.

“We have not had this many new hotels open in such a short span of time in more than a decade,” says Virginia Haley, president of Visit Sarasota. “With expanded sporting events, cultural offerings and meetings, there is a demand for more hotel rooms. I am optimistic that our expanded sales efforts during the past several years will keep these hotels full year-round. VSC has initiated a robust plan to aggressively market these new and existing rooms in inventory.”

Just opened on July 28, 2017, the 255-room Westin Sarasota brings 26,000 sf of upscale meeting space and a rooftop pool and bar area to Sarasota. The Westin Sarasota joins the recently opened Zota on Longboat Key. The Zota offers 187 rooms and with approximately 5,000 sf of meeting space, making it ideal for corporate retreats and programs.

Art Ovation Hotel, an Autograph Collection by Marriott is scheduled to open a 162-room property with two suites and several on-site restaurants in November 2017 and in early 2018 The Embassy Suites by Hilton will open a 19-floor property offering 180 suites. Carlisle Inn, in the heart of Pinecraft, an Amish and Mennonite community within the city of Sarasota, will open its first hotel with nearly 100 rooms and 4,000 sf of meeting space in late 2017. Finally, The Sarasota Modern: A Tribune Portfolio Hotel with 89 rooms is slated to open in 2018 in the trendy Rosemary District downtown.

These additional hotels join the 139-room Aloft Sarasota which opened in downtown Sarasota in early 2016. The Aloft offers 550 sf of flexible meeting space in the city.
